Common Sources of Air Leaks in Properties



Recognizing typical sources of air leaks is crucial for enhancing a property's power effectiveness. These leaks often take place in various areas of a building, significantly affecting heating and air conditioning prices. Typical wrongdoers include gaps around doors and home windows, where seals might deteriorate gradually. In addition, electric outlets and switches can create pathways for air exchange otherwise correctly insulated. Attic rooms and cellars are also constant sources, particularly where wall surfaces meet the roof covering or the structure. Various other potential leakage points consist of pipes penetrations, venting systems, and the areas bordering smokeshafts. Older homes might experience from weakened building products, enhancing vulnerability to air seepage. By identifying these common resources, homeowner can take positive steps to seal leaks, consequently enhancing total power efficiency and convenience within their spaces. Addressing these problems is an important part of establishing an airtight solution for any home.


Methods of Power Screening: Blower Door and Thermal Imaging



Efficient energy testing techniques, such as blower door examinations and thermal imaging, play an essential function in diagnosing air leakages within a residential property. The blower door test entails pressurizing or depressurizing a structure to determine air movement and determine leaks. A calibrated fan is set up in an outside doorway, and the resulting pressure difference highlights locations of undesirable air infiltration. This approach measures the overall airtightness of the structure.Thermal imaging enhances blower door tests by visually detecting temperature level variants on surfaces, revealing concealed air leakages.
